Tim Osburn on Granite Mt. Summit

Date: Jan 26, 2007
Height:  5,629 feet
Location:  I-90 Exit 47
Route:  Straight up
Length: ~6 miles round-trip
Elevation Gain: 3,800 FT
Fantastic weather, soft snow, and 3800 feet elevation gain with maybe 2000 feet of glissading!

  The view from Mt. Defiance (1 mile from summit)
  

Date: Sep 17th, 2006
Height:  4,960 feet
Location:  10 miles east of Cascade Locks, Oregon
Route:  Starvation Ridge trail to Mt. Defiance trail, returning on Mt. Defiance trail.
Length: 12.5 miles round-trip
Elevation Gain: 4,935 FT

Name: Mt Adams &#8211; South Spur
Date:  Aug 11 &#038; 12th, 2006
Height:  12,276 feet
Location:  15 miles north of Trout Lake, Washington
Route:  South Climb Trail #183
Length: 11.4 miles round-trip
Elevation Gain: 6,676 FT
Partner:  Josh Townsley
